To calculate the volume of a rectangular prism, you can use the formula:

\[
\text{Volume} = \text{Length} \times \text{Width} \times \text{Height}
\]

To express the volume in cubic inches, you need to know the specific dimensions (length, width, and height) of the shipping box. Since the actual dimensions are not provided in your question, you can replace "Length", "Width", and "Height" with the specific values you have.

For example, if the dimensions of the box are given as \( l \) inches for length, \( w \) inches for width, and \( h \) inches for height, then the volume can be expressed as:

\[
V = l \times w \times h
\]
